| 2008 - Rieussec |
| Apr 23, 2009 |
|
|
| Wow what a beautiful pale golden color (clean and clear). Absolutely
intoxicating aromas of peach, ripe citrus, and apricot confiture. Shows
tons of botrytis but remains fresh and lively on the mid-palate. Lots
of toasty marshmallow and charred oak with everything in the right
place (and in the right proportion). Loaded with fruit, but replete
with the proper acidty… Delicious and rich |

| 2001 - Castelnau De Suduiraut |
| Great year, but too much of the good juice is in first label. |
| May 15, 2008 |
|
|
| Bright golden color, clear along the edges. Nose of Botrytis, dried pineapple and saffron. Full bodied, overly sweet, needs more acidity. Finished with botrytis and saffron notes. Hot finish. |

| 1972 - Barton & Guestier Sauternes |
| still going strong |
| May 12, 2008 |
|
|
| I know that this is not an estate-bottled, fancy, cru. Nevertheless,
after 35 years or so, it was delicious. There was enough sugar so that
the wine still had a hint of sweetness, and as one might imagine, all
the other flavors were resolved. Perfect balance. I am partial to
Sauternes, but this was a beauty that I bought on a lark last fall.
Amazing. |
